> BIG problem: I kept several backup files in /etc/modules.d/ like
> alsa.old, alsa.old.zip, but even Gentoo put some files there during
> updates, maybe ._.alsa and the like.

Oh gosh!! I'm sorry. I've been burned by exactly the same thing.
Another issue about modules-update (or update-moduels) is that should
there be a problem with the format of a single file the script stops
but doesn't tell you. You then reboot to find things aren't right
again, and stuff is missing from modprobe.conf.
